OSM and State regulatory authorities use the information collected by 30 CFR Part 800 to ensure that persons conducting or planning to conduct surface coal mining and reclamation operations post and maintain (1) an appropriate liability insurance policy and (2) a performance bond in a form and amount adequate to guarantee fulfillment of all reclamation obligations.
This submission represents a net increase of 35,190 hours from the currently approved collection burden for 30 CFR Part 800, due to an increase in burden state regulatory authorities in the release of bonds, increasing the burden for that part from 112,627 hours to 147,817. This collection will see a non-wage cost reduction of $10,600 due to a reduction in use.
